AI events
Fiscal Q1 revenue reached $480.5 million, 6% above the prior-year period, while gross margin improved to 26% from 21% and the operating loss narrowed to $10.9 million. Adjusted EBITDA nevertheless declined to $53.4 million from $56.6 million, leaving execution and underlying profitability as key tests after the positive initial reaction [#SEC-8K-2026-09-09].
Management retained FY2027 revenue guidance of $2.125-$2.225 billion, adjusted EBITDA of $305-$325 million, and adjusted EPS of $3.02-$3.34. Conversion against those ranges is the principal event path through the fiscal year; acquisition integration, government-contract timing, and demand remain explicit assumptions [#SEC-8K-2026-09-09].
Bookings totaled $0.7 billion, quarterly book-to-bill was 1.4, and funded backlog rose 37% year over year to a record $1.5 billion. Management identified manufacturing-capacity expansion and supply-chain strengthening as priorities, supporting growth if firm orders convert without material cost or schedule slippage [#SEC-8K-2026-09-09].
